The Early stages of Audiology

The origins of audiology can be dated back to ancient ages when societies such as the Egyptians and Greeks were the very first to recognize and record hearing difficulties. It was not up until the 19th century that a more systematic investigation of hearing began. The advancement of the ear trumpet in the late 18th century, a basic tool developed to improve for those with hearing obstacles, represented among the initial efforts to tackle hearing loss.

The Birth of Advanced Audiology

The pivotal moment for audiology came after World War II, as thousands of veterans returned home with noise-induced hearing loss triggered by direct exposure to loud surges and equipment. This created an urgent need for efficient treatments and rehab services, catalyzing the establishment of audiology as an official occupation. Audiologists started with standard diagnostic tests to assess hearing loss and quickly moved towards developing more sophisticated audiometric methods.

Technological Developments and Important Learnings

Among the most considerable developments in audiology included the development of the electronic hearing aid in the 20th century. Early models were bulky and limited in functionality, but the development of digital innovation in the latter half of the century changed listening devices style, making gadgets smaller, more powerful, and capable of providing a clearer sound quality.

The introduction of cochlear implants in the 1970s represented another major leap forward. These complex electronic gadgets might directly stimulate the acoustic nerve, offering a sense of noise to individuals with profound deafness who could not benefit from traditional listening devices.
In current years, audiological research study has actually likewise broadened beyond the mechanics of hearing loss to consist of the psychosocial elements, comprehending how hearing impairment affects communication, cognition, and quality of life. This holistic view of hearing health has caused a more thorough approach to treatment, integrating technical solutions with counseling and acoustic rehab.

Today's Digital Age and Beyond

Currently, audiology is at the forefront of the digital age, with progress in artificial intelligence (AI), telehealth, and individualized medicine affecting the instructions of hearing health care. Contemporary hearing devices such as hearing aids and cochlear implants use AI technology to adjust to various environments, providing a high degree of clarity and personalization. The accessibility of tele-audiology services, enabled by internet connections, has actually increased the availability of hearing care by allowing remote assessments, fittings, and discussions.
